Quote:
Originally posted by Francis Cole:
<BLOCKQUOTE>The speed limit is exactly that. A limit, not a target
But yet if I am doing 50mph on a 60mph road I get told I would fail my test for that </BLOCKQUOTE>

Depends on the road itself and the conditions. There's plenty of de-restricted roads (i.e. the national speed limit of 60) where it's not safe to drive at that speed no matter what and so you wouldn't be expected to. If it's a wide and straight road with good visibility, then yeah you probably would be though. The key is appropriate speed.
